The statistical length defines the number of slots to be measured per segment. You
can measure an entire NPUSCH transmission or only a part of it. The "current" result
of a segment refers to the last measured slot of the statistical length. Additional statisti-
cal values (average, minimum, maximum and standard deviation) are calculated for the
entire statistical length. The following figure provides a summary.
Two consecutive segments are often measured at different analyzer settings. The
R&S
CMW changes the analyzer settings in the last two slots of a segment. These last
two slots of each segment are automatically excluded from the measurement.
Results of other slots that cannot be measured accurately (because of overflow, low
signal or synchronization error) can also be discarded automatically (parameter
= Off). The reached statistical length, a reliability indicator for the
measurement and a reliability indicator for the segment are included in most measure-
ment results.
Maximum number of measured slots
The limit of 4000 measured slots comprises measured slots included in a statistical
length. The not measured slots of an active segment do not contribute. Other contribu-
tions that "cost" slots are inactive segments and triggering of a segment.
All segments selected for the measurement are considered. In the worst case, the sum
of the following components must not exceed 4000:
●
One slot per inactive segment
●
Two times the number of triggered segments
●
Per active segment: Slots in the statistic count of the segment plus three slots
Trigger modes
A list mode measurement can either be triggered only once, or it can be retriggered at
the beginning of specified segments.
In "Once" mode, a trigger event is only required to start the measurement. As a result,
the entire range of segments (up to 1000) is measured without additional trigger event.
The trigger is rearmed after the measurement has been finished. The retrigger flag of
the first segment specifies which trigger source is used (IF power trigger or trigger
source configured via global trigger settings). The retrigger flags of subsequent seg-
ments are ignored.
The "Once" mode is recommended for UL signals with accurate timing over the entire
range of segments.
